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Support bun as a runtime for language servers #1321

Open
dbaeumer opened this issue Sep 19, 2023 · 7 comments
Open

Support bun as a runtime for language servers #1321

dbaeumer opened this issue Sep 19, 2023 · 7 comments
Labels
feature-request Request for new features or functionality help wanted Issues identified as good community contribution opportunities
Milestone

Comments

@dbaeumer
Copy link
Member

No description provided.

@dbaeumer dbaeumer added this to the Backlog milestone Sep 19, 2023
@dbaeumer dbaeumer added the feature-request Request for new features or functionality label Sep 19, 2023
@dbaeumer dbaeumer added the help wanted Issues identified as good community contribution opportunities label Oct 9, 2023
@willviles
Copy link

Because the lack of language server support for the Bun runtime, is everyone up until now using Bun and not having the DX benefit of ESLint & other linting plugins running within the IDE?

This is the one big DX blocker I've encountered when switching from Node and unsure if I'm missing something here.

@smokeelow
Copy link

Waiting for this one 🤞

@sdykae
Copy link

sdykae commented Jun 14, 2024

please

@itsmnthn
Copy link

wen supported?

@dbaeumer
Copy link
Member Author

As always a PR would speed things up since I have currently no experiences with bun.

@gshpychka
Copy link

bunx --bun typescript-language-server --stdio seems to work already, but no noticable speedup

@chrisbbreuer
Copy link

chrisbbreuer commented Dec 16, 2024

@Jarred-Sumner any idea how one could work around this issue? A rather annoying issue for Vue devs, too, because , for example, linting Vue with antfu's eslint config, will crash the vscode eslint server, breaking all other interactions until force restarted.

Linting other files (js, ts, json), it handles without an issue

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
feature-request Request for new features or functionality help wanted Issues identified as good community contribution opportunities
Projects
None yet
Development

No branches or pull requests

7 participants